Welcome to our family-run animal sanctuary in the Catskills, just 13 minutes from Woodstock and Saugerties. This isn’t just a tour—it’s a chance to connect with our rescued animals, hear their incredible stories, and experience their unique personalities up close.

Every interaction is special because we let the animals set the pace. Our donkeys and goats eagerly soak up attention, while our emus cautiously but excitedly eat from your hand. Some animals love pets, others need space, and we honor their choices—though more often than not, they’re happy to meet new friends!

Step into the peaceful world of Napping Horse Farm, a 30-acre animal sanctuary nestled in the scenic Catskills. This private, hands-on tour is a relaxing and joyful experience for animal lovers of all ages.

Meet a variety of rescued animals — from gentle horses and curious donkeys to playful goats, quirky emus, and more. Along the way, you'll hear inspiring stories, enjoy up-close encounters, and have plenty of photo opportunities in a truly magical setting.

Whether you're feeding an emu a snack, scratching a donkey’s favorite spot, or simply soaking in the mountain views with animals by your side, this is a unique way to slow down and connect with nature.
